Are people in Castle Pines older or younger than people in Dacono?- The Median Age in Castle Pines is 11.6 years older than in Dacono.
Are housing costs cheaper in Castle Pines or Dacono?- Castle Pines
housing costs are 68.2% more expensive than Dacono hous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Castle Pines or Dacono?- The average commute for residents of Castle Pines is 3.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Dacono.

Things to do in Castle Pines?Located just south of Denver, Castle Pines is an affluent community in Douglas County, Colorado. Known for its lush landscapes, luxury amenities, and great schools, the area has become a popular home for those seeking to escape the hustle and bustle of the city. The community boasts some of the most beautiful golf courses in Colorado and is surrounded by breathtaking views of the Rockies. With its close proximity to downtown Denver, residents can enjoy all the perks of city life without sacrificing their privacy and serenity that come from living in a smaller town.
